Federal Reserve Chair Powell under criminal investigation over HQ renovation

The U.S. attorney's office for the District of Columbia has opened a criminal investigation into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ell, focusing on the renovation of the central bank's Washington headquarters and whether he was truthful in his congressional testimony about the project.
Officials told The New York Times, which was first to report the probe, that it centers on whether Powell accurately characterized the scope and cost of the renovation during congressional appearances.
